在Web开发中,我们经常需要在不同的页面之间进行跳转,这可以通过多种方式实现,其中一种常见的方法是使用JavaScript的window.location对象,如果我们想要使用更简洁、更强大的工具,例如jQuery,我们也可以实现这个功能。

我们需要引入jQuery库,你可以在你的HTML文件中添加以下代码来引入jQuery库:

<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script>

我们可以使用jQuery的.attr()方法来改变当前页面的URL,从而实现页面跳转,以下是一个简单的示例:

$(document).ready(function(){
    $("#myButton").click(function(){
        window.location.href = "http://www.example.com";
    });
});

在这个示例中,当用户点击id为"myButton"的元素时,页面将跳转到" ↗"。

这种方法有一个问题,那就是它会立即跳转到新的页面,而不会等待当前的JavaScript代码执行完毕,如果你需要在跳转之前执行一些操作,你可能需要使用其他的方法。

另一种方法是使用jQuery的.load()方法,这个方法会加载指定的URL的内容,并将其插入到当前元素中,以下是一个简单的示例:

$(document).ready(function(){
    $("#myButton").click(function(){
        $("#myDiv").load("http://www.example.com");
    });
});

在这个示例中,当用户点击id为"myButton"的元素时,id为"myDiv"的元素的内容将被替换为" ↗"的内容。

jQuery跳转页面的实现方法

请注意,这两种方法都需要服务器的支持,如果你尝试直接从文件系统加载一个HTML文件,浏览器可能会阻止这种行为。